1. Prevent Costly Breakdowns
One of the biggest reasons to schedule regular HVAC maintenance is to avoid expensive emergency repairs. By inspecting your system early, our technicians can catch small problems before they turn into major, costly issues.

2. Improve Energy Efficiency
When your HVAC system is running at peak efficiency, it doesn’t have to work as hard to keep your home comfortable. Regular maintenance helps ensure your system is working at its best, which can result in:
- Lower energy bills
- Improved airflow
- Better temperature control

3. Extend the Lifespan of Your System
HVAC systems are a significant investment, so you want to get as many years as possible out of them. With regular tune-ups and maintenance, your system will last longer, reducing the chances of unexpected breakdowns.
Pro tip: Most HVAC systems last about 10-15 years with proper maintenance. Without it, you could be looking at costly replacements sooner.
4. Ensure Better Indoor Air Quality
Your HVAC system does more than heat or cool your home — it also affects the air you breathe. A well-maintained system with clean filters can help reduce allergens, dust, and mold in the air. This is especially important for families with asthma or allergies.
5. Stay Ahead of Seasonal Changes
Whether it’s cooling your home in summer or heating it in winter, regular HVAC maintenance helps prepare your system for seasonal changes. We recommend scheduling maintenance twice a year — once before the cooling season and again before heating season.

7. Save Money in the Long Run
Although HVAC maintenance has a small upfront cost, it’s a money-saver in the long run. Regular tune-ups lower your risk of expensive breakdowns, reduce your energy bills, and extend your system’s life.
